
The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) has announced a change of venue for the party’s Board of Trustees (BoT) Meeting.
Naija News reports that heightened tension prevailed on Monday at the National Secretariat of the PDP in Abuja, as security operatives barred members of the party’s BoT from holding a scheduled meeting.
The meeting, which was expected to be held in the NEC Hall of the PDP’s Wadata Plaza headquarters in Wuse Zone 5, was disrupted by a heavy security presence.
Uniformed officers reportedly sealed off the premises and ejected those already inside.
According to Daily Trust, a senior officer was overheard issuing strict instructions to his men, directing that no form of gathering should take place within the building.
In a terse statement via its official 𝕏 handle, the opposition party disclosed that the meeting, earlier scheduled to be held at 10 am at the Party’s National Secretariat in Abuja, has been moved to the Yar’Adua Centre, Central Business District, Abuja.
The statement reads, “Special Announcement! Change of Venue for the PDP Board of Trustees (BoT) Meeting. The Meeting of the Board of Trustees (BoT) Meeting of the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P), @OfficialPDPNig, earlier scheduled to be held by 10 Am at the Party’s National Secretariat in Abuja has been moved to Yar’Adua Centre, Central Business District, Abuja.
“All BOT members are by this notice advised to proceed to the new venue.”
